随着游戏行业的蓬勃发展,越来越多的开发者选择独立制作游戏,或者是从事游戏开发相关工作。对于许多人来说,购买游戏源码无疑是一个高效且省时的方式,因为通过购买现成的游戏源码,不仅能节省大量的开发时间,还能获取到一些专业的功能和技术支持。在哪里可以购买到优质的游戏源码呢?下面,我们将为你推荐一些值得信赖的途径,帮助你找到合适的游戏源码资源。
最直接也是最常见的方式是通过专门的游戏源码交易平台来购买。类似于UnityAssetStore和UnrealMarketplace这样的平台,都有大量的游戏源码资源。这些平台上有成千上万种不同类型的游戏源码供选择,涵盖了从2D到3D、从简单休闲游戏到复杂大型游戏的各种需求。开发者可以根据自己的需求,浏览这些平台的资源库,选择符合自己项目要求的源码。
UnityAssetStore是Unity引擎的官方资源市场,提供了多种类型的游戏源码。无论你是制作射击游戏、角色扮演游戏、平台游戏还是益智游戏,都能在这里找到丰富的资源。该平台不仅提供游戏源码,还有大量的素材、插件以及工具,帮助开发者提高效率。UnityAssetStore的优势在于,你能够得到非常详细的资源描述、用户评价和示范视频,这些都能帮助你做出更明智的选择。
UnrealMarketplace是基于虚幻引擎(UnrealEngine)开发的官方平台,针对使用虚幻引擎的开发者,提供了大量的高质量游戏源码、蓝图和艺术资源。虚幻引擎本身就以其强大的图形渲染能力和丰富的开发工具而著名,因此,UnrealMarketplace上有很多适合大型、复杂游戏的源码,能够满足开发者对高性能、高质量的需求。
除了官方平台,第三方游戏源码交易网站也是一个不错的选择。这些网站虽然不属于任何特定的游戏引擎,但他们通常会提供多平台兼容的游戏源码,开发者可以在这些网站上根据自己的需求,找到不同引擎和平台的源码。比如,Chupamobile、Itch.io和CodeCanyon等平台,提供了各种不同风格、不同类型的游戏源码,价格也较为亲民。许多第三方平台不仅有便捷的支付方式,还支持退款保障,让开发者购买更加放心。
值得注意的是,不同平台上的游戏源码质量参差不齐,因此,选择时一定要关注源码的评分和评价。一个高评分的游戏源码,往往意味着它的质量得到了其他开发者的认可,使用起来更为稳定、可靠。
部分开发者选择在GitHub等开源代码库寻找游戏源码,GitHub上有大量的开源游戏项目,开发者可以免费下载并修改这些源码,以便根据自己的需要进行二次开发。虽然这种方式成本较低,但也要求开发者具备一定的编程技能,能够理解和修改源码。对于一些基础较为薄弱的开发者来说,可能会遇到一定的技术难题。
购买游戏源码的途径有很多种,开发者可以根据自己的需求和预算来选择合适的平台。在选择游戏源码时,尽量选择那些有详细说明、用户评价高的资源,以确保源码的质量和功能。我们将继续探讨如何在这些平台上选择适合自己的游戏源码,以及一些购买游戏源码时需要注意的事项。
在购买游戏源码时,选择合适的源码非常重要。如何确保自己购买的游戏源码既符合项目需求,又能够顺利实施呢?以下几个方面是每位开发者在选择游戏源码时必须要考虑的重要因素。
明确你的项目需求是最基本的前提。每个游戏的开发要求都不同,有的可能是2D平台游戏,有的可能是复杂的3D模拟游戏,有的则需要多人联网对战系统。在购买游戏源码时,务必先明确你的游戏类型、引擎选择以及功能需求。比如,如果你的游戏需要高质量的物理效果和逼真的场景渲染,那么选择虚幻引擎(UnrealEngine)的游戏源码会更合适;如果你的项目是一个移动平台的休闲游戏,Unity引擎的游戏源码可能会更加符合要求。
评估游戏源码的代码质量至关重要。一个高质量的游戏源码,通常具有清晰的注释和结构良好的代码。开发者需要仔细查看源码的文档,检查代码是否易于理解和修改。特别是当你需要对源码进行定制化开发时,代码的可扩展性和易用性将直接影响开发效率。如果购买的是第三方平台的游戏源码,一定要留意其他用户的反馈,看是否有报错或性能问题,避免购买到质量不高的源码。
检查资源和插件的完整性也是非常重要的。很多游戏源码会附带一些附加资源,如角色模型、背景音乐、特效动画等。这些资源可以大大节省开发时间,并为游戏带来更高的完成度。在选择源码时,记得检查附带的资源是否丰富且符合你的需求。某些游戏源码可能会附带第三方插件,这些插件可以增加游戏的功能或提升游戏的性能,但在购买时要确保这些插件的版权和合法性,以免后续出现版权***。
再者,关注游戏源码的技术支持和社区活跃度也非常关键。一个好的游戏源码往往会有活跃的开发者社区或专业的技术支持团队。当你在开发过程中遇到问题时,可以及时获取帮助。比如UnityAssetStore和UnrealMarketplace等平台,都提供了强大的社区和技术支持。如果你购买的源码没有足够的技术支持,那么可能在开发过程中遇到的问题就无法及时解决,进而影响开发进度和质量。
价格和许可证的选择也需要仔细考虑。虽然购买游戏源码可以节省时间和精力,但不同平台和不同质量的游戏源码价格差异较大。有些高质量的游戏源码可能售价较高,但其提供的功能和资源可以帮助你节省更多的开发成本。购买前务必了解清楚源码的价格和授权方式,避免未来因为版权问题产生不必要的麻烦。
总结来说,购买游戏源码是一种非常高效的游戏开发方式。通过选择优质的游戏源码,开发者能够大大缩短开发周期,提高工作效率。在选择游戏源码时,一定要根据自己的项目需求、预算以及技术能力来做出明智的选择。关注源码的质量、功能、支持等多方面的因素,确保最终购买的源码能够顺利应用到自己的项目中。
通过以上的介绍,相信你已经对购买游戏源码有了更深入的了解。不论你是资深的游戏开发者,还是初入游戏开发领域的新手,合理利用游戏源码资源,能够让你的游戏项目事半功倍,取得更好的开发成果。